BIRATNAGAR: A total of 569 people have been infected with the coronavirus in Province 1 in the last 24 hours.

According to the Ministry of Social Development, 223 women and 346 men tested positive in PCR tests of 1,960 samples during the period.

Of the infected, 253 infected are from Morang, including 147 are in Biratnagar, 143 from Jhapa, 112 from Sunsari, 12 from Udayapur, 11 from Ilam, four from Dhankuta, three from Bhojpur, two from Solukhumbu, one each in Panchthar, Khotang and Tehrathum and 26 from outside the Province, according to the Ministry of Social Development.

The number of infected people in the Province has reached 18,953.

As many as 619 people have returned home after recovering in the last 24 hours, taking total recovered cases to 10,798.
